I recently upgraded to Adobe CS3.
When I launched Dreamweaver 9 for the first time, it seemed to find all my sites defined in Dreamweaver 8 but when I try and connect to the ftp, I found that although it copied the sites, it did not include the ftp address, username or passwords. Is there any way to get all the information to go in. I have over 20 sites defined and would hate to have to manually enter the information again. |

the info should have been copied over-
to do it manually, open dw8 menu->site->manage sites select a site, click export. click yes to include ftp info save the .ste file in a folder rinse/lather/repeat for the other sites open dw9 menu->site->manage sites Import button. -- Alan Adobe Community Expert, dreamweaver http://www.adobe.com/communities/experts/ |
